At your location, 10 Hour General Industry Course

This course is part of the OSHA Outreach Training and participants who successfully complete the course will receive a 10 Hour General Industry card directly from OSHA.   The course reviews the hazards associated with general industry through a review of OSHA regulations and focuses on the prevention of injuries associated with the hazards.

The 10 Hour OSHA General Industry wallet card has a statement on it that ‘This course completion card does not expire.’  Some General Industry companies may not accept the card if it has been over three years since the card was issued.  Five years may the maximum life of the card for other companies.

DESIGNATED TRAINING TOPICS

 

10-HOUR GENERAL INDUSTRY

OUTREACH TRAINING PROGRAM

 

The 10-hour program is intended to provide a variety of General Industry safety and health training to entry level workers.

Of the below topics, six hours are mandatory and two hours must be chosen from the optional topic list.  For

the remainder of the class, I can teach any other general industry hazards or policies and/or expand on the required topics.

Instructional time must be at least 10 hours.

 

The 10-hour classes are intended for workers.  Therefore I emphasize hazard identification, avoidance, control and

prevention,not OSHA standards. 

                                                       REQUIRED COURSE TOPICS

 

One Hour

Introduction to OSHA, including:

■ OSH Act, General Duty Clause, Employer and

   Employee Rights and Responsibilities, Whistleblower

   Rights, Recordkeeping basics

■ Inspections, Citations, and Penalties

■ Value of Safety and Health

■ OSHA Website and available resources

■ OSHA 800 number

 

Choose at least 2 of the following topics

These topics must add up to

at least 2 hours:

- Minimum One-half hour each -

Hazardous Materials (Flammable and Combustible Liquids, Compressed Gases, Dipping and Coating), Subpart H

Materials Handling, Subpart N

Machine Guarding, Subpart O

Introduction to Industrial Hygiene, Subpart Z

Bloodborne Pathogens, Subpart Z

Ergonomics

Safety and Health Programs

Fall Protection

 

 

One Hour

Walking and Working Surfaces, Subpart D

One Hour

Exit Routes, Emergency Action Plans, Fire Prevention Plans, and Fire Protection, Subparts E & L

One Hour

Electrical, Subpart S

 

One Hour

Personal Protective Equipment (PPE),  Subpart I

 

One Hour

Hazard Communication, Subpart Z

 

Special Industry Recommendation:

In addition to the six required hours, the groups noted below should also teach the following:

•  Medical / Health Care – 1 hour each - Introduction to Industrial Hygiene, Bloodborne Pathogens

At least ฝ hour each – Ergonomics and Workplace Violence

•  Maintenance - Ergonomics and (if applicable) Powered Industrial Trucks

•  Utility - Ergonomics, Power Generation, and Confined Spaces

•  Office - Ergonomics
